Timeline

Timeline

1884
birth Burslem United Kingdom Source:8698368 Source:8698253 9th February 1884
1907
employment Solicitor Burslem Stoke-on-Trent United Kingdom Source:8698368 1907
1911
marriage Catherine Bratt Source:8698368 16th July 1911 - 29th January 1923
1914
service British Army Captain North Staffordshire Regiment Transport 3/5th Battalion Source:8698368 October 1914
1923
marriage Dulcie Arton-Powell Source:8698368 26th March 1923
1938
awards Medal of the Order of the British Empire (MOBE) British Award/Decoration Source:8698359 1938
1942
death Ndola Zambia Source:8698368 May 1942
